What Arminta Means

A variation of Araminta, likely a variant of Aminta, a Greek name of uncertain meaning. Sometimes associated with 'defender of mankind'.

Arminta, a variation of Araminta, likely stems from the Greek name Aminta, with debated meanings sometimes including 'defender of mankind.' Its most notable bearer, Araminta Ross, was the birth name of Harriet Tubman, imbuing it with profound historical significance.
